A Market which opened to the upside lost momentum and trended lower during the session finishing mixed. The DJIA and S&P500 managed small gains at the close while the Nasdaq100 finished to the downside.  At the close, the DJIA was up 49 points, the S&P500 moved up 3 points, and the Nasdaq100 again the big loser down 0.7%.  Breadth was positive, 1.2 to 1, on above average volume.  Volume enhanced by options expiration.  For the week, the DJIA was up 0.7%, the S&P500 off 0.7%, and the Nasdaq100 pulling back 2.3%. The DJIA closed the week at a new high and its RSI remains high at 74. Near term support for the DJIA is now 11867 and 11777. Near term resistance becomes 11889 and 11900. The S&P500 held above 1275, but the MACD is slightly negative.  Near term support remains at 1275 and 1262. 1275 is critical support.  Near term resistance becomes  1288 and 1300. The Nasdaq100 closed near its 20D-SMA and its RSI dropped to 53.  Its MACD remains negative, as it was the weakest of the three major indices for the week.  Near term support is now 2262 and 2250.  Near term resistance now becomes 2275 and 2288.  The VIX was up for the fourth straight session, 2.6% to 18.47.  It moved just above its 50D-SMA.

                                                            

Trading Trend

Long term, the bias remains to the upside for all three major indices.  Short term, bias continues to the upside.  Near term, the weakness in the Nasdaq100 is making the DJIA new high suspicious as the Nasdaq100 has been the leader of the indices. The Nasdaq100 is suggesting more near term weakness, while the S&P500 still has support near 1275 before more downside risk.  Earnings reports will continue to impact the Market.  Futures at(8:15am) are flat to slightly higher versus fair value.  The European debt crisis and U.S. economic recovery confirmation are the top Market movers.
